-1
A
回答
0
你能砍使用逗號分隔的列表中的數據驗證列表使用隱藏範圍,UDF和多個命名範圍。
首先將UDF(注意我已經使用塔A作爲值的存儲庫 - 其可以被隱藏):
Public Function DVList(Cell As Range) As Range
Dim i As Long, arr() As String: arr = Split(Cell.Value, ",")
For i = 0 To UBound(arr)
Range("A1").Offset(i) = arr(i)
Next i
Set DVList = Range(Range("A1"), Range("A1").Offset(UBound(arr)))
End Function
然後設置一個命名範圍如「DVList1」與公式「= DVList(工作表Sheet1!$ I $ 4)」,其中工作表Sheet1!$ I $ 4包含以逗號分隔值的字符串
最後補充一個數據驗證列表單元以 「= DVList1」
名單將現在被填充了值
這個範圍相當有限;所以你需要爲逗號分隔的每個單元格設置一個不同的命名範圍。但您可以根據自己的需求進行編輯。
相關問題
- 1. Excel VBA驗證列表到單元格中的逗號分隔列表
- 2. 使用gspread獲取逗號分隔的單元格值列表
- 3. 來自單個單元格的Excel數據驗證列表
- 4. Excel函數來根據逗號分隔列表從表格中總結數值
- 5. VBA用於分隔逗號分隔單元格的函數
- 6. 使用逗號分隔數據列名的數據表格
- 7. 包含逗號分隔值的Mysql計數單元格
- 8. 從數據庫中刪除逗號分隔列表中的值
- 9. 逗號分隔值單倒引號和逗號分隔值
- 10. 逗號分隔的列表
- 11. 將Excel單元格中的逗號分隔值列表更改爲唯一的值列表和計數
- 12. 使用正則表達式在Pandas系列的單個單元格中分隔逗號分隔的值
- 13. 如何從Oracle Apex的表格單元格中的逗號分隔值列表中選擇列表?
- 14. PHP MYSQL - 搜索逗號,逗號分隔列表分隔列表
- 15. 驗證以逗號分隔的值列表是否遵循特定的序列
- 16. rails 3驗證郵件地址的逗號分隔列表
- 17. 正則表達式來驗證用逗號分隔的數字或破折號
- 18. 將表格列中的逗號分隔值分隔成使用mysql的行嗎?
- 19. Oracle中單獨的逗號分隔值
- 20. 當單元格的值由逗號分隔時複製行
- 21. 逗號分隔值列出
- 22. 數組項的逗號分隔列表
- 23. 數組元素中的逗號分隔電子表格
- 24. 正則表達式來驗證逗號分隔字符串
- 25. 從單個單元格中提取用逗號分隔的數據
- 26. 以逗號分隔,製表符分隔格式組合數據
- 27. 逗號分隔值分隔
- 28. 逗號分隔數據庫中所有列的列表(Tablename | Column_names ...)
- 29. 將逗號分隔列表中的值從其他逗號分隔的列表中刪除
- 30. 在Google表格中,如何分隔逗號分隔值?
你有什麼試過?堆棧溢出不是我網站的代碼。 –
對不起,斯科特,我試過使用公式,但沒有運氣。只是尋求幫助。 – Gooney
@Gooney:使用公式可能非常困難。使用VBA將是最好的(最簡單的)幫助你在這裏。盡力編寫VBA解決方案。如果您仍然遇到問題,請回復您嘗試過的代碼。 – abraxascarab